Divergence and conservation of the meiotic recombination machinery Biology Diagrams The sympathetic trunk is a fundamental part of the sympathetic nervous system, and part of the autonomic nervous system. It allows nerve fibres to travel to spinal nerves that are superior and inferior to the one in which they originated. Also, a number of nerves, such as most of the splanchnic nerves, arise directly from the trunks.

The sympathetic trunk is a paired structure of nerve fibers that runs along both sides of the vertebral column. It is a key part of the autonomic nervous system, specifically the sympathetic division, and extends from the base of the skull down to the coccyx. The trunk consists of a chain of interconnected sympathetic ganglia that are located lateral to the vertebral bodies.
